Good's syndrome (thymoma and hypogammaglobulinaemia) is a rare secondary immunodeficiency disease, previously reported in the published literature as mainly individual cases or small case series. We use the national UK-Primary Immune Deficiency (UKPID) registry to identify a large cohort of patients in the UK with this PID to review its clinical course, natural history and prognosis. Clinical information, laboratory data, treatment and outcome were collated and analysed. Seventy-eight patients with a median age of 64 years, 59% of whom were female, were reviewed. Median age of presentation was 54 years. Absolute B cell numbers and serum immunoglobulins were very low in all patients and all received immunoglobulin replacement therapy. All patients had undergone thymectomy and nine (12%) had thymic carcinoma (four locally invasive and five had disseminated disease) requiring adjuvant radiotherapy and/or chemotherapy. CD4 T cells were significantly lower in these patients with malignant thymoma. Seventy-four (95%) presented with infections, 35 (45%) had bronchiectasis, seven (9%) chronic sinusitis, but only eight (10%) had serious invasive fungal or viral infections. Patients with AB-type thymomas were more likely to have bronchiectasis. Twenty (26%) suffered from autoimmune diseases (pure red cell aplasia, hypothyroidism, arthritis, myasthenia gravis, systemic lupus erythematosus, Sjögren's syndrome). There was no association between thymoma type and autoimmunity. Seven (9%) patients had died. Good's syndrome is associated with significant morbidity relating to infectious and autoimmune complications. Prospective studies are required to understand why some patients with thymoma develop persistent hypogammaglobulinaemia.

This is the second report of the United Kingdom Primary Immunodeficiency (UKPID) registry. The registry will be a decade old in 2018 and, as of August 2017, had recruited 4758 patients encompassing 97% of immunology centres within the United Kingdom. This represents a doubling of recruitment into the registry since we reported on 2229 patients included in our first report of 2013. Minimum PID prevalence in the United Kingdom is currently 5·90/100 000 and an average incidence of PID between 1980 and 2000 of 7·6 cases per 100 000 UK live births. Data are presented on the frequency of diseases recorded, disease prevalence, diagnostic delay and treatment modality, including haematopoietic stem cell transplantation (HSCT) and gene therapy. The registry provides valuable information to clinicians, researchers, service commissioners and industry alike on PID within the United Kingdom, which may not otherwise be available without the existence of a well-established registry.

Human papillomavirus (HPV)-induced cutaneous warts are potentially serious and debilitating. In immunosuppressed patients, these warts may be resistant to standard therapies. We report a case of a young patient with a primary immune deficiency whose recalcitrant cutaneous warts regressed completely following administration of a quadrivalent HPV vaccine.

Idiopathic hypogammaglobulinaemia, including common variable immune deficiency (CVID), has a heterogeneous clinical phenotype. This study used data from the national UK Primary Immune Deficiency (UKPID) registry to examine factors associated with adverse outcomes, particularly lung damage and malignancy. A total of 801 adults labelled with idiopathic hypogammaglobulinaemia and CVID aged 18-96 years from 10 UK cities were recruited using the UKPID registry database. Clinical and laboratory data (leucocyte numbers and serum immunoglobulin concentrations) were collated and analysed using uni- and multivariate statistics. Low serum immunoglobulin (Ig)G pre-immunoglobulin replacement therapy was the key factor associated with lower respiratory tract infections (LRTI) and history of LRTI was the main factor associated with bronchiectasis. History of overt LRTI was also associated with a significantly shorter delay in diagnosis and commencing immunoglobulin replacement therapy [5 (range 1-13 years) versus 9 (range 2-24) years]. Patients with bronchiectasis started immunoglobulin replacement therapy significantly later than those without this complication [7 (range 2-22) years versus 5 (range 1-13) years]. Patients with a history of LRTI had higher serum IgG concentrations on therapy and were twice as likely to be on prophylactic antibiotics. Ensuring prompt commencement of immunoglobulin therapy in patients with idiopathic hypogammaglobulinaemia is likely to help prevent LRTI and subsequent bronchiectasis. Cancer was the only factor associated with mortality. Overt cancer, both haematological and non-haematological, was associated with significantly lower absolute CD8(+) T cell but not natural killer (NK) cell numbers, raising the question as to what extent immune senescence, particularly of CD8(+) T cells, might contribute to the increased risk of cancers as individuals age.

Common Variable Immunodeficiency (CVID) comprises a heterogeneous group of primary antibody deficiencies which lead to a range of complications, including infectious, neoplastic and inflammatory disorders. This report describes monozygotic twin brothers with CVID who developed cryptogenic liver disease and subsequently hepatopulmonary syndrome (HPS). This is the second report of the association of HPS and CVID. Its occurrence in two identical twins implicates a genetic basis.

The expression of genes specifically in B cells is of great interest in both experimental immunology as well as in future clinical gene therapy. We have constructed a novel enhanced B cell-specific promoter (Igk-E) consisting of an immunoglobulin kappa (Igk) minimal promoter combined with an intronic enhancer sequence and a 3' enhancer sequence from Ig genes. The Igk-E promoter was cloned into a lentiviral vector and used to control expression of enhanced green fluorescent protein (eGFP). Transduction of murine B-cell lymphoma cell lines and activated primary splenic B cells, with IgK-E-eGFP lentivirus, resulted in expression of eGFP, as analysed by flow cytometry, whereas expression in non-B cells was absent. The specificity of the promoter was further examined by transducing Lin(-) bone marrow with Igk-E-eGFP lentivirus and reconstituting lethally irradiated mice. After 16 weeks flow cytometry of lymphoid tissues revealed eGFP expression by CD19+ cells, but not by CD3+, CD11b+, CD11c+ or Gr-1+ cells. CD19+ cells were comprised of both marginal zone B cells and recirculating follicular B cells. Activated human peripheral mononuclear cells were also transduced with Igk-E-eGFP lentivirus under conditions of selective B-cell activation. The Igk-E promoter was able to drive expression of eGFP only in CD19+ cells, while eGFP was expressed by both spleen focus-forming virus and cytomegalovirus constitutive promoters in CD19+ and CD3+ lymphocytes. These data demonstrate that in these conditions the Igk-E promoter is cell specific and controls efficient expression of a reporter protein in mouse and human B cells in the context of a lentiviral vector.

The production of murine monoclonal antibodies against specific antigens by hybridomas is a well utilised technique. The production of hybridomas secreting specific human antibodies would have many advantages in therapeutic applications of monoclonal antibodies. The immortalised human lymphocytes themselves would also provide valuable tools in research on lymphocyte development. Preparation of human-human hybridomas has been limited by a lack of suitable fusion partners. This protocol paper describes the production of human-mouse heterohybridomas by two independent laboratories. The purpose of this protocol is to provide a basis for the development of heterohybridoma technology in laboratories with limited hybridoma experience.
